"I'll write you, Ultimate Poem, if it's the last thing I do." In Unseen Creatures, poet/cryptid Garrison Benson invites readers on a wild ride through worlds at once fantastic and earthy, playful and melancholy. With the help of a lively cast of characters from Bigfoot to Old Man Bruggers to wannabe cowboy Jonah, Benson explores undiscovered regions of disillusionment, hospitality, belonging, and interbeing in this endearing and enduring love letter to the often-glimpsed, never-seen creatures moving inside us all.
